Going forward, every payment submission must carry a client-generated idempotency key, persisted before the first attempt and reused on all retries. As a contractor implementing this, please follow the key-generation and storage conventions exactly — partial adoption is worse than none. The full specification is on the internal page below.

operations page: https://jenkins.zemvarcloud.local/job/merge_requests/repo/build/73930b4b30f0a8ed

## Further reading

Cache invalidation in the Bramblewick catalog service is the most common source of stale-price bugs, so read up before touching anything in `catalog/cache`. The short version: writes publish invalidation events to the Fenwick bus, and each edge node evicts keys on receipt, with a 90-second TTL as a backstop. There are known race conditions around bulk imports, which is why imports bypass the cache entirely. The full design doc, including the event schema and eviction ordering guarantees, lives at the page linked below.

operations page: https://jira.qorvelsys.internal/browse/pages/browse/pages

Minutes — Management Meeting, Velmor Appliances. Attendees: R. Castell, J. Omura, P. Branvik. Warranty costs on the Torvex dishwasher line ran 22% over forecast this quarter, driven by pump-seal failures in units shipped from the Dalreth plant. Finance to reclassify the accrual and restate the Q3 provision by Friday. A supplier claim against Korvane Components is being drafted. The revised warranty outlook informs the plan summarised below.

board note of kageg-bahof: The renewal with Holwynax Holdings closes at $2 million a year, 5 percent below the last contract. Project Ulaath slips by two quarters because of the supplier delay.

- [ ] **Step 7: Breaker override escrow.** After sealing the signing keys for the Tallgrove upstream API circuit breaker, confirm the support team can force the breaker open during a full outage. The override bundle lives in the sealed escrow drawer and is useless without its unlock phrase. Two ceremony witnesses must initial this step before proceeding. The escrow bundle is decrypted with the recovery passphrase that follows.

vault phrase of kahip-kahop = holath-quenmir